As the weather starts to cool and the leaves start to change, my appetite gravitates towards all things warm, creamy, cozy and comforting. That can mean everything from a hearty One-Pot Lentil & Vegetable Soup with Parmesan to zippy, spicy Butternut Squash & Black Bean Enchiladas. These recipes make use of some of the best flavors fall has to offer, including squash, root vegetables and the lingering tomatoes of summer. Plus, they also focus onanti-inflammatory ingredientslike leafy greens, fish, beets, whole grains and healthy fats so you can enjoy a delicious meal that helps reduce your risk ofhigh cholesterol, high blood pressure, heart diseaseand more. Beet & Goat Cheese Salad
This stunning winter salad gets its sweet, earthy flavor from roasted beets and balsamic vinegar. Creamy goat cheese and peppery arugula add color and balance, while toasted walnuts add crunch. A mandoline is the best way to get thin, even slices from the roasted beets.

White Bean & Sun-Dried Tomato Gnocchi
Jacob Fox
Sun-dried tomatoes are the star of this recipe—providing texture and umami. Combined with the spinach, they make this dish a great source of vitamins C and K.

One-Pot Lentil & Vegetable Soup with Parmesan
Antonis Achilleos
This lentil-vegetable soup is packed with kale and tomatoes for a filling, flavorful main dish. If you have it, the Parmesan cheese rind adds nuttiness and gives the broth some body.

Sheet-Pan Shrimp & Beets
For this easy sheet-pan dinner, beets get a head start in the oven while you prep the shrimp and kale. For a prettier presentation, leave the shrimp tails intact. Serve this one-pan recipe with a cool glass of rosé.

Chicken Chili Verde
Prepared salsa verde adds tang to this fast weeknight chili recipe and pairs beautifully with the rich caramelized chicken and creamy beans. Don’t shy away from the poblano peppers. They offer a mild heat but deliver a depth of flavor you can’t find in regular green bell peppers.

Hearty Chickpea & Spinach Stew
This satisfying stew comes together in a snap. Mashed chickpeas add body to the broth, and tomato paste adds a savory note without piling on the sodium. To simplify the prep, look for chopped fresh onion and shredded carrot or a soup starter mix in the produce section.

Slow-Cooker Mediterranean Diet Stew
With a focus on vegetables, fiber-rich legumes and healthy fats, this slow-cooker stew fits the bill forthose following the Mediterranean diet. Swap out the chickpeas for white beans for a different twist, or try collards or spinach in place of the kale. A drizzle of olive oil to finish pulls together the flavors of this easy vegan crock-pot stew.
